1.1.1.2 Intercept Routing
Description
Redirects incoming outside (CO) line calls via the Direct Inward System Access (DISA) or Uniform Call
Distribution (UCD) feature to a preprogrammed destination when the original destination does not, or
cannot, answer the call. There are 2 types of Intercept Routing, described below.

Type Description
No Dial While or after hearing a DISA outgoing message (OGM) or after hearing a dial tone
(short beep), if the caller does not dial anything or enters an unrecognised input, the
call is redirected to preprogrammed intercept destinations in the following priority:
DISA IRNA to BV—Day/Night/Lunch [438-440] Flexible Ringing—Day/Night/Lunch
[408-410]
Intercept
Routing—No
Answer (IRNA)
If a called party does not answer a call within a preprogrammed time period ( DISA
Ring Time before Intercept [508], UCD Ring Time before Intercept [525]), the call is
redirected to preprogrammed intercept destinations in the following priority:
DISA IRNA to BV—Day/Night/Lunch [438-440] Flexible Ringing—Day/Night/Lunch
[408-410]
